Oscar off to Boomers trials

Sixer and local ABLer, Oscar Forman, got a call from Brian Goorjian yesterday. He's off to a Boomers camp next week, selected as one of six players in trials for the final four positions for an upcoming Boomers tour of China and Japan.

Not sure who the other five players are, which six are already in the squad (I think it might be a depleted squad with Bogut and Andersen missing, amongst others) and thus what his chances are.

Should be good experience getting a tough workout under another coach and training outside the Sixers system for some variety.

I'm assuming that Jacob Holmes would also be involved as one of the guaranteed six or those in trials -- can anyone confirm?

Good luck to both of them either way. A great opportunity no matter what happens.

Boomers Squad is now on www.basketball.net.au for the camp Oscar is going to.
2005 Boomers squad*

David Andersen (unavailable),
Stephen Black,
Andrew Bogut (unavailable), Aaron Bruce (unavailable),
CJ Bruton,
Ben Castle,
Peter Crawford,
Oscar Foreman,
Wade Helliwell,
Russell Hinder,
Jacob Holmes,
Daniel Kickert (unavailable), Alex Loughton,
Sam Mackinnon (unavailable), Aleksander Maric,
Steven Markovic (unavailable), Damian Martin (unavailable), Brad Newley (unavailable), Matthew Nielsen,
Andrew Rice,
Damien Ryan (unavailable),
Glen Saville,
Luke Schenscher (unavailable), Jason Smith,
Greg Vanderjagt,
Mark Worthington.
